Ellie Mental Health in Southlake is seeking a Child & Adolescent Therapist or Registered Play Therapist to join our team!

About the Job:

Who is Ellie?

Ellie Mental Health is a highly successful multi-clinic mental health organization based in Minnesota. Ellie clinics are structured to remove many of the daily obstacles that get in the way of providing world-class mental health services. Ellie makes the clinicians experience a priority by offering: excellent compensation, benefits, training, and flexible scheduling. Not to mention providing centralized administrative, technology, referral and inquiry support, scheduling, client/therapist matching, billing and collections, and even CEU programs. Ellie strives to lower the administrative aspects of providing care to the absolute minimum, so our practitioners have more time to focus on what they love - serving clients! We want our people to be happy because happy therapists do better work and provide better client care!

Responsibilities and Duties
  • Evaluate mental health diagnosis, create and implement a treatment plan, complete ongoing documentation including further diagnosis, treatment plan reviews, and case notes according to company policy
  • For Full-Time status clinicians must maintain a caseload of a minimum of 27 client visits per week
  • Provide excellent customer service for clients and collaborate with a dynamic team to further the mission of filling gaps in our community
  • Utilize creativity in interventions to help clients achieve and exceed goals
  • Prepare and submit individual documentation for each session per company guidelines and protocol
  • Coordinate services with case managers, families, work personnel, medical personnel, other Ellie staff, and school staff as needed
  • Attend and participate in all clinical staff meetings and trainings

Required Qualifications and Skills
  • Candidates are required to have a masters degree in one of the behavioral sciences or related fields from an accredited college or university and on track to obtain licensure in their designated field
  • Candidates MUST have Texas-issued clinical licensure (LMFT, LPC, LCSW, etc.)
  • Required experience with completing DAs, treatment plans and clinical case notes
  • Required experience with children, adolescents and teens
  • Effective written and verbal communication skills
  • Ability to demonstrate and model stable, appropriate boundaries with clients
  • Ability to complete and submit documentation of services and other documents in a timely manner
  • Comfort and familiarity working with a diverse client base
  • Proficient in the use of typical office technology (computers, e-mail, etc.) and Electronic Health Record systems (Procentive experience a plus!)
  • Ability to pass a background check.
Preferred Qualifications and Skills
  • Preferred that candidates have a fully licensed mental health professional (LCSW, LMFT, LPC, LP) with a valid state of Texas License.
  • Preferred experience with parenting, couples & families
  • Ideal candidates will have a general knowledge of therapy services, community resources, insurance billing, and previous experience with mental health documentation
